If you’re not a student or don’t qualify for the Office Professional Academic Deal you can still purchase Office 2010 Student Edition from places such as Amazon.com for the price of $124.95. However, please note that Microsoft Office 2010 Professional is superior to the Office 2010 Student Edition as there are more Microsoft programs included with the Pro version. Here are the programs you get on MS Office 2010 Professional:
- Word 2010
- Excel 2010
- PowerPoint 2010
- OneNote 2010
- Outlook 2010
- Publisher 2010
- Access 2010
And here is what you get with MS Office Home & Student Edition:
- Word 2010
- Excel 2010
- PowerPoint 2010
- OneNote 2010
